dc.description.abstractTwo new (saccharinato)silver (I) complexes, [Ag<inf>2</inf>(sac) <inf>2</inf>(pyet)<inf>2</inf>] and [Ag<inf>4</inf>(sac)<inf>4</inf>(pypr) <inf>2</inf>] (sac = saccharinate, pyet = 2-pyridineethanol and pypr = 2-pyridinepropanol), have been prepared and characterized by elemental analyses, IR, thermal analysis and single crystal X-ray diffraction. Both complexes crystallize in triclinic space group of P1̄. In [Ag<inf>2</inf>(sac) <inf>2</inf>(pyet)<inf>2</inf>], two monomeric [Ag(sac)<inf>2</inf>(pyet)] units are doubly bridged by the sulfonyl oxygen atoms of the sac ligands, forming an [Ag<inf>2</inf>(sac)<inf>2</inf>(pyet)<inf>2</inf>] dimer, in which each silver (I) centre is three coordinate with a T-shaped coordination and the Ag-Ag separation is 5.205 Å. The dimeric units are connected by strong O-H⋯O<inf>sulfonyl</inf> intermolecular hydrogen bonds into a one-dimensional chain running parallel to b. The one-dimensional hydrogen bonded chains are further linked by π(sac)-π(pyet) stacking interactions. The tetranuclear complex, [Ag<inf>4</inf>(sac)<inf>4</inf>(pypr)<inf>2</inf>], is achieved by bridging of [Ag<inf>2</inf>(sac)<inf>2</inf>] with two [Ag(sac)(pypr)] units through the sulfonyl oxygen atoms of the sac ligands. The two silver (I) ions in the centre with a short Ag-Ag bond distance of 2.8480(13) Å exhibit a T-shaped geometry with three sac ligands, while the two terminal silver (I) ions are coordinated by a sac ligand and a pypr ligand in a near linear geometry.
